Frequently asked questions

What's the difference between Anse Marcel and Orient Bay?+
Two neighbouring bays (10 min by car) with radically opposed atmospheres. Anse Marcel: round and protected bay, calm beach, translucent sea without waves, discreet luxury atmosphere (Le Domaine, Riu Palace), no colourful lolos, no active water sports, ideal for absolute rest and honeymoon. 70 % privatised by hotels. Orient Bay: long 2 km beach facing the Atlantic, constant trade winds, sometimes wavy sea, colourful lolos (Bikini, Waikiki, Kakao), festive atmosphere, world-class kitesurf spot, full free access. Ideal for those who love animation, sports and beach life. If you stay 7 days in Saint Martin and hesitate: spend 2 days at Orient Bay (animation) and 5 days at Anse Marcel (rest).
How to access Anse Marcel beach without being a hotel client?+
Public beach access is legally guaranteed in France (coastal law), even though Le Domaine and Riu Palace privatise a large part. Park at the free car park at the marina entrance (200 m from the beach), walk down via the marked path. The public zone concentrates on the east side of the bay (left side on arrival). You can lay down your towel, swim, enjoy the bay. Bring everything (umbrella, water, snacks) — restaurant/sun lounger services are reserved for hotel clients. Some public sun loungers can be rented at the La Plage restaurant (next to the marina) with consumption. Avoid settling too close to privatised zones (discreet but real signage).
Is Le Domaine Beach Resort worth its price?+
Le Domaine Anse Marcel Beach Resort (4-star, classed superior 5-star depending on period) is one of Saint Martin's iconic hotels since the 1990s. 130 rooms facing the beach, full infrastructure (3 pools, spa, 4 restaurants, tennis courts, gym), upscale French service. Rates: €250-500/night for two in standard room without breakfast, €350-700 in suite, €500-1,200 in villa. Value for money is decent for Saint Martin (expensive island) but inferior to comparable establishments in Guadeloupe or Martinique. Advantages: exceptional location (facing private beach), French-speaking service, quality dining. Limits: 1990s architecture (renovated but not ultra-modern). Alternative: Riu Palace (all-inclusive, more dining services but more standardised international atmosphere).
Are there water activities at Anse Marcel?+
Anse Marcel is more oriented to relaxation than active sports, but still offers some activities. At the beach: paddle (€15-25/hour), kayak (€10-15/hour), small catamaran (€40-80/hour), mask-snorkel for snorkelling along the rocks. At the marina: private boat trips to the wild coves of the north (Anse Mary's, Tintamarre, €80-150/person depending on service), full-day catamaran rental (€300-600/day for 6-8 people with skipper), diving with Scuba Fun (PADI-certified centre, try-dive €80-110, exploration €70-95). For more active water sports (kitesurf, windsurf, jet-ski), head to neighbouring Orient Bay (10 min by car).
How many days at Anse Marcel?+
To fully enjoy Anse Marcel as a base, plan 3 to 7 days as part of a complete Saint Martin stay. Three days are enough to rest, enjoy the beach and do 1-2 excursions (Orient Bay, Grand-Case). Five days allow adding Pinel, Tintamarre, and a day in Marigot. Seven days or more for those prioritising pure rest (honeymoon, wedding trip). If you're on a short stay (3-5 days), Grand-Case offers a better compromise (gastronomy + beach). Anse Marcel is more suitable for 7-day-plus stays, where you accept devoting time to pure rest in discreet luxury mode.
